Seating
Bariatric wheelchairs are developed to support a bigger weight capacity than basic wheelchairs. They typically have broader seats and armrests, which provide higher stability for people of heavier construct. Their frames are also made with stronger products to stand up to greater stress and stress, making them suitable for daily use in your home or in a healthcare facility. The seating location of a bariatric chair is also able to accommodate varying physique by changing the seat height and angle. Those who need to be seated for extended periods of time should search for chairs with padded elevating footrests that are adjustable, as they supply increased convenience and security for the user.
Wheelchairs that are too small or inadequately fitted can trigger discomfort and discomfort for the person using them. This can result in a large range of avoidable negative results, such as muscle atrophy, impaired food digestion, depression, and pressure injuries. It is therefore important that the best wheelchair is selected to match a person's medical needs and lifestyle.

When selecting a self propelled bariatric folding wheelchair wheelchair, it is necessary to evaluate the client's strength, series of motion, muscle tone, and orthopedic status throughout an assessment. These aspects are going to affect their ability to self move a manual wheelchair and will likewise impact their seating system requires.
Another important aspect to consider is the size of the frame. Some producers use a variety of various frame sizes to accommodate differing body heights and sizes. It is essential to pick a frame that is both lightweight and sturdy enough for the customer's needs.
Many long term care settings have a restricted variety of manual wheelchairs in their fleet and storeroom. These wheelchair bases tend to be somewhat insufficient in terms of seating and self-propulsion, but they are the finest that they can do based on the budget plan and accessibility. It is vital to work with the supplier to understand the requirements and advocate for a broader variety of wheelchair alternatives as part of that fleet.
We have actually found that there are some extremely useful resources, both free and for a fee, to assist with training someone to navigate a manual wheelchair. One example is a program called the Wheelchair Skills Test and Training Program by Lee Kirby. There are likewise many books and videos on the topic. We recommend that anybody who plans on utilizing a manual wheelchair as a day-to-day transport gadget look for these resources to become skilled in their use.
